We have an exciting opportunity for a Quality Manager to join our team in Rotorua working on the Bay of Plenty East Network Outcomes Contract (BOPE NOC).
The contract covers the area including Rotorua, Whakatane, Opotiki, and Kawerau districts. The region includes maintenance of 570 km of State Highways and pavement widely diverse in nature including remote coastal roads, rugged logging roads, and heavily populated tourist bus trails.
As the Quality Manager, you’ll lead and facilitate all quality assurance, systems, and process requirements. You’ll play a key role in ensuring compliance with integrated management systems and procedures, maintaining high quality standards, and delivering contract outcomes on time.
